Development of interactive textbooks based on blended learning to improve students scientific literacy during the Covid-19 pandemic a) Biology Study Program, University of Nahdlatul Wathan Mataram, Lombok, Indonesia Abstract This research is a development research that aims to develop an interactive textbook based on blended learning that is feasible, practical and effective to improve students^ scientific literacy during the Covid-19 pandemic. The development model used is the ADDIE (Analysis, Design, Development, Implementation and Evaluation) model. Interactive textbook testing and scientific literacy tests were carried out on class X students at a high school in East Lombok-NTB. The trial design of this study used the One Group Pre-test-Post-test Design. The results showed that blended learning-based interactive textbooks obtained an average score of 81%, scientific literacy instruments 76%, syllabus 84%, RPP 81%. The results of the development of interactive textbooks that have been implemented in chemistry learning have an effect in the form of increasing students^ scientific literacy on oxidation reduction reaction material by 68.3% with a high category. These results indicate that the developed blended learning-based interactive textbook has valid, practical and effective criteria to improve students^ scientific literacy during the Covid-19 Keywords: development- blended learning- scientific literacy- Covid-19 Topic: Chemistry Education |
